问题标签 [npx]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
63 浏览

react-native - 为什么要用 npx 初始化一个 react-native 项目?

今天我尝试做一些不同的事情,并使用 npx 启动了一个 react-native 项目,并解决了诸如找不到 react-native 命令之类的问题,你确定这是一个 android 项目等,而 expo 和 react 更容易-本机初始化。

所以我想知道,根据你的说法,有什么优势,npx 更多的是什么?

0 投票
1 回答
140 浏览

javascript - 无法使用传递给“npm start”的参数配置 React Pre Hook

我创建了一个全新的项目:

这里是回购:https ://github.com/tlg-265/test-react-app

我创建了一个新脚本:/prepare-project.js具有以下内容:

文件内容:/package.json是:

您可以在其中看到我配置了pre hook

我的目标是运行:

所以在脚本里面:/prepare-project.js我可以读取那个值。

我试过:

尝试从脚本内部读取该值时没有运气:prepare-project.js.

关于如何实现这一目标的任何想法?

谢谢!

0 投票
1 回答
1259 浏览

npm - npx create-react-app 不工作,文件已经存在

我已按照建议在全球范围内卸载了 create-react-app。然后我跑了npx create-react-app test,出现以下错误

我在网上搜索并尝试了以下npm cache clean --force. 不工作。

我确保全局卸载 create-react-app。然后跑了which create-react-app

它给了我一个错误

所以现在我将不得不这样做npm install -g create-react-app,不再推荐?

如果您之前通过 npm install -g create-react-app 全局安装了 create-react-app,我们建议您使用 npm uninstall -g create-react-app 卸载该软件包,以确保 npx 始终使用最新版本。

我该如何解决?

0 投票
1 回答
358 浏览

bash - 从 Bash 脚本运行 NPX 创建 React 应用程序

我正在尝试创建一个运行的 bash 脚本npx create-react-app my-app

我当前的脚本:

我尝试简单地调用 npx 命令并直接指向二进制文件,但是当执行脚本时(来自 Alfred 工作流),我没有看到创建的 React 应用程序。

如果我/usr/local/bin/npx create-react-app my-app从终端运行,那么我确实看到了 React App Created。

0 投票
1 回答
445 浏览

node.js - 如何在不使用 npx 全局安装的情况下从包中运行 cli 命令

我正在尝试@foal/cli使用 npx 运行 cli 命令以避免全局安装。

按照文档,我应该执行以下操作:

我试图用来npx避免包的全局安装。

这篇文章之后,我尝试了以下方法:

知道如何实现这一目标吗?

0 投票
1 回答
2369 浏览

javascript - 创建 ESLint CLIEngine 时出现问题

尝试使用 eslint

但得到:

0 投票
1 回答
1570 浏览

reactjs - NPX create-react-app 找不到 @typescript-eslint/experimental-utils@2.19.1 的匹配版本

我在新计算机上并尝试运行npx create-react-app myapp,但收到​​此错误。以前从来没有这个,看起来它缺少 es-lint 包?

0 投票
2 回答
1150 浏览

npm - `npx 创建-nuxt-app` 不工作:MacOSX

我使用 MacOS High Sierra。对于任何有 Nuxt.js 经验的人来说,该命令 npx create-nuxt-app <project-name> 对我根本不起作用!

npm我一直在说我需要更新我的依赖项时遇到错误。我首先尝试使用npm outdated(检查过时的包)和 npm update <pkg name>. 这没有用。

我还卸载并重新安装nodenpm厌倦了上述(和以下进程)。仍然没有工作。

无论我做什么,终端一直说我core-js需要更新,所以我这样做了(我尝试了两者npm i core-jsnpm i core-js) - 他们没有工作。

为了更新npm依赖关系,我使用了npm install -g npm-check-updates后面跟着的命令ncu -u,然后尝试了npm updatenpm install。到目前为止没有任何效果。

最后,我尝试创建一个,package.json因为npm抱怨我没有 package.json,所以我使用npm init并按照说明提交创建的文件创建了一个。仍然,运行后什么都没有npx create-nuxt-app <project-name>

怎么了?有没有人遇到过这个问题?我真的很喜欢 Nuxt.js,我已经尝试了一整天,但我放弃了使用 NuxtJS。

编辑:我设法通过从头开始创建 Nuxt 应用程序来解决我的部分问题。但是,我收到以下错误:

npm ERR! code ELIFECYCLE npm ERR! errno 1 npm ERR! nuxt-app@2.11.0 dev:nuxt npm ERR! Exit status 1 npm ERR! npm ERR! Failed at the nuxt-app@2.11.0 dev script. npm ERR! This is probably not a problem with npm. There is likely additional logging output above.

0 投票
3 回答
13176 浏览

reactjs - 发生意外错误:“https://registry.yarnpkg.com/error-ex/-/error-ex-1.3.2.tgz:请求失败\“404 Not Found\”

当我尝试使用 create-react-app 创建一个新的 react 应用程序时,我得到了以下信息:

而我的本地环境信息是这样的:

有人知道这里发生了什么吗?

0 投票
0 回答
306 浏览

node.js - npx create-react-app 不起作用,如何解决?

收到错误并且 npm start 不起作用,node 版本 10.15.3 npm 版本 6.4.1 错误:

这是怎么解决的?搜索了 SO 和 google,没有找到好的解决方案。Mac osx 高seirra

更新到节点 12.6.1,现在错误是权限: